HB25-1259 is NOW LAW
Thank you for helping protect access to fertility care in Colorado

This new law ensures all Coloradans can pursue family-building options with greater security and without unnecessary barriers. Colorado Fertility Advocates (CFA) proudly supported
HB25-1259 because we believe every Coloradan deserves equitable access to fertility and reproductive health care. Our board, members (including many of you!), and other Coloradans who have benefited from IVF and other reproductive treatments courageously shared stories to show why protecting access to IVF and fertility treatments matters for all families.
Over 10,000 individuals voiced their support for this bill to Colorado legislators, and thanks to your advocacy, HB25-1259 was signed into law by Governor Polis on May 7, 2025. Learn more about the bill and why CFA supported it here.

Restorative (or “Ethical IVF”) is next battlefield

While national promises of “expanded IVF access” have caused confusion and delays for families seeking fertility care, attacks on reproductive freedom continue across the country. The latest front in this battle is the push for “Restorative Reproductive Medicine (RRM)” or “Ethical IVF.”

While these approaches may sound appealing with terms like “natural” and “healthy,” the reality is different. RRM and “Ethical IVF” often impose ideologically driven restrictions that limit patient care and access to IVF and other family-building options. As the American Society for Reproductive Medicine explains, “What distinguishes RRM is not medical practice but ideology.” These approaches typically exclude IVF on moral or religious grounds (not clinical evidence) and falsely claim that standard fertility care ignores proper diagnosis and healing, when in fact, IVF is often the only path to parenthood for many families.

At Colorado Fertility Advocates, we stand firmly for evidence-based, patient-centered fertility care for ALL families (not just "certain types of families.”). Just as we fought to pass HB25-1259 to protect IVF access in Colorado, we will join others in opposing policies and narratives that seek to limit reproductive care under the guise of “ethics” or “restoration.”
